Here's a perfect example cheating. I am going to use the videogame NHL 09.

In NHL 09, EA came out with a online mode that embedded Be-A-Pro and the Online Team Play from NHL 08. The result was the EA Sports Hockey League which literally allowed NHL 09 to run away with the competition last year regarding sport games. Over the course of the game's lifespan, players began to find ways to shoot the puck in order to increase their goal scoring. To a degree they are simple dekes and dangle moves which throw off the AI of the goaltender. Of course that's what happens when a player dangles; yet there are specifics shot which have an 80% chance of going in. The players call these shots glitch goals and curve shots. Again these are simple exploits which are primitive compared to what cheating is being done in FPS games.

But there was one actual cheat that was far beyond primitive. It was the 99 Glitch. There were individuals who had the ability to max out each of their player's attributes to 99(making your player an 99 overall) which isn't possible(since the highest overall is within the 80s). By January 2009 about 95% of players had done this. Later on a patch came out preventing the 99 glitch, as well as being more critical with penalties.

In NHL 09 what prevents a cheater from scoring? A team that knows how to play real hockey. A solid defensive pair can keep the score low, and puck passing forwards find their team scoring more. You should see how crazy some division 1 teams are in the EASHL on the forecheck.
